Volume 27 - 1st printing. Collects Fantastic Four (1961-1996 1st Series) #286-296. Written by John Byrne, Roger Stern, Chris Claremont, Jim Shooter, and Stan Lee. Art by John Byrne, Jerry Ordway, Jackson "Butch" Guice, Barry Windsor-Smith, Kerry Gammill, Ron Frenz, Al Milgrom, John Buscema, Marc Silvestri, Terry Austin, Joe Sinnott, Al Gordon, P. Craig Russell, Vince Colletta, Bob Wiacek, Klaus Jansen, Steve Leialoha, and Joe Rubenstein. Cover by John Byrne. Introduction by Michael Higgins. Comic master John Byrne concludes his all-time great run on Fantastic Four, and celebrates the teams 25th anniversary! John Byrne concludes his iconic tenure as Fantastic Four writer/artist and he's going to make history every step of the way! He begins with the shocking resurrection of Jean Grey. How do you follow that up? With the return of the true Doctor Doom in a next-level war with the Beyonder! Then, our heroes journey into the Negative Zone with Nick Fury to face Blastaar and a resurgent Annihilus, but when their return trip catapults them to 1936 they're faced with a classic dilemma. Do you stop Nick Fury from killing Hitler? It all builds a triple-sized 25th anniversary extravaganza that seeks to bring the Thing back into the fold, set where else but Monster Island?
